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cazuza's Saki | Chinese Red Pika |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(प्राणी) | Animalia (प्राणी)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(रज्जुकी) | Chordata (रज्जुकी) |
| Class same | Mammalia (स्तनधारी) | Mammalia (स्तनधारी) |
| Order | Primates (नरवानर गण) | Lagomorpha (खरहारूपी) |
| Family | Pitheciidae | Ochotonidae |
| Genus | Pithecia | Ochotona |
| Species | Pithecia cazuzai | Ochotona erythrotis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Cazuza's Saki and Chinese Red Pika share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(स्तनधारी)
